## Further reading

Feedcheck validates podcast RSS before publish: enclosure sizes, episode GUIDs, namespace quirks across the Wrenbird aggregators. Known gaps: no chapter-marker checks yet, and strict mode rejects some legacy feeds. For the sync: failure-rate dashboard review is item three. Spec, known issues, and the roadmap are kept on the page here.

runbook for fawif-bajop: https://jira.novaccorp.internal/settings

## Building Plugins for StageView

StageView renders seat maps for the Ardenmoor Playhouse booking system. Plugins receive a normalized seat graph — rows, sections, and accessibility flags — and return a render layer. Your plugin must not mutate the graph directly; use the overlay API instead. Pricing tiers arrive as opaque tokens, so never hardcode tier colors. Test against the sandbox venue before submitting for review. The full plugin contract, versioning policy, and submission checklist live on the page below.

runbook for kahof-yaweg: https://superset.tolvaqdyn.test/settings/repo/projects/display/68a0f19bdd1535be

14:22 — The new SQL linter on Copperline started rejecting every migration because of a tab-vs-space rule nobody remembered enabling. Rollouts stalled for about forty minutes until Priya toggled the rule to warn-only. Lesson for newcomers: lint config changes need a dry run first. The offending pipeline run is identified below.

session token of bawep-yadup = htk21_528abd376e3c5a4ec24a1

## Changelog — Font vendoring defaults changed

As of this release, the Bracken UI build no longer fetches third-party fonts at build time. All typefaces used by the Lanternwell suite are now vendored into the repo under a dedicated assets directory, and the fetch step is skipped by default. If you're onboarding, nothing to install — the fonts travel with the checkout. The build flags controlling this behavior are listed below.

settings of hadup-yafog:
LAMAEL_PIN=3761
LAMAEL_TENANT=istmir
LAMAEL_METRICS_HOST=metrics.lamael.plorvasys.test
LAMAEL_SEAL=seal_8ea68500
LAMAEL_STANDBY_TEAM=fraok